Output 40bacf903c9a8ff63b61139bd55de021ffae0ca95fb5c33b3871b93057d956fa:0

value
9899966909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5feead22d1ebfb9eee82b7339bcf522138d426 OP_EQUAL
address
3L95Lnh672tMo3kK44su3pHmhRnMto2kpD
transaction
40bacf903c9a8ff63b61139bd55de021ffae0ca95fb5c33b3871b93057d956fa
spent
true